Because the majority of people in the world are casual music listeners, not fanatics like us. Progressive rock isn't particularly accessible, so its not going to rank highly on the Billboard 200, which ranks based on popularity not quality. Anyway, quality is subjective. The music that is ranked highly there has just as much worth to the right person as ELP or Pink Floyd. QED.
